Mathematica has a new study out today on the effectiveness of Teach For America teachers. I pull out some of the big findings—and provide some context—in a new TPM column today:
Five years ago, TFA received a federal grant to rapidly grow its number of teachers—this new research was conducted as part of that expansion. Here’s the topline finding: The study found that “for both math and reading, TFA teachers were equally as effective as traditionally certified comparison teachers (including both novices and veterans).”Click here to read the rest."
